Finland and Estonia<br />
In Finland, demand and sales were good during 2011<br />
both in the Helsinki area and in a number <strong>of</strong> regional<br />
centers. The number <strong>of</strong> unsold homes is low, and the few<br />
that remain are mainly in Estonia, where the market is<br />
still weak. In Finland, the focus during the year has thus<br />
primarily been on starting up new projects and acquiring<br />
land for development <strong>of</strong> future residential areas. More<br />
than 1,000 homes were started in Finland, and <strong>of</strong> these<br />
more than 900 were pre-sold. The demand for new<br />
homes is expected to remain at a good level in 2011.<br />

Czech Republic and Slovakia<br />
In the Czech Republic and Slovakia, <strong>Skanska</strong> is developing<br />
homes in Prague and Bratislava, with the potential to<br />
start projects in regional growth centers during 2011.<br />
Interest among buyers began to recover after a sharp<br />
downturn in 2009. During <strong>2010</strong>, sales <strong>of</strong> both previously<br />
completed homes and new projects improved.<br />
The number <strong>of</strong> unsold homes fell in the Czech Republic,<br />
but in Slovakia the recovery was slower. Sales during<br />
the year totaled 415 homes, and 415 homes were started,<br />
mainly in Prague. This makes <strong>Skanska</strong> one <strong>of</strong> the biggest<br />
market players.<br />
Demand is expected to increase somewhat in 2011,<br />
stimulated by the greater willingness <strong>of</strong> banks to provide<br />
loans and allow higher loan-to-value ratios.<br />
